Good things to know

Which word is more common?

Uneven is more commonly used than unsymmetric in everyday language. Uneven is versatile and covers a wide range of contexts, while unsymmetric is less common and typically used in technical or scientific contexts.

What’s the difference in the tone of formality between unsymmetric and uneven?

Unsymmetric has a more formal and technical connotation, while uneven can be used in both formal and informal contexts.
